What is VoiceXML? How does it relate to J2ME?

Bill Day

Voice eXtensible Markup Language (VoiceXML) specifies an XML-based markup language for speech recognition and synthesis applications using landline and mobile phone systems. Many J2ME-enabled devices will support a voice channel, and as such may also be used to interact with VoiceXML-based services over the phone voice connection.

VoiceXML also enables markup-based approaches to recognizing DTMF key input (the tones made when you press a key on a touch tone phone handset) and recording spoken input.

